How much do developer operations software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for developer operations software engineer in Parkville, MD is $106,078.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$85,400.00 and $123,300.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Developer Operations Software Engineer vs DevOps Engineer?

AspectDeveloper Operations Software EngineerDevOps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's in CS or related field, certifications like AWS, DockerBachelor's in CS or related field, certifications like AWS, Jenkins
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with development and operations teams, often in agile settingsWorks across development, QA, and operations, focusing on automation and CI/CD
Industry UsageCommon in tech companies, startups, and enterprises adopting DevOps practicesWidely used in organizations implementing continuous integration and deployment

The Developer Operations Software Engineer and DevOps Engineer roles share many credentials and work environments, focusing on streamlining software deployment and infrastructure. While their responsibilities overlap, the Developer Operations Software Engineer emphasizes integrating development and operations processes, whereas the DevOps Engineer often leads automation and CI/CD pipelines. Both roles are vital in modern software development, with the titles sometimes used interchangeably depending on the organization.

Job Title: Senior Software Engineer - Cybersecurity & DevOps
Job Category: Engineering
Time Type: Full time
Minimum Clearance Required to Start: TS/SCI with Polygraph
Employee Type: Regular
Percentage of Travel Required: None
Type of Travel: None
* * *
The Opportunity
CACI is seeking a Senior Software Developer to join our dynamic team and contribute to critical cybersecurity initiatives! We are seeking a skilled Software Developer with DevOps experience to enhance our Active Network Defense (AND), Computer Network Defense (CND), and Information Security Continuous Monitoring (ISCM) capabilities. This role offers the chance to make a significant impact by ensuring the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of our customer systems. If you are passionate about information security and eager to work in a fast-paced environment, this is the perfect opportunity for you.
Responsibilities
  • Develop applications, APIs, scripts, and services.
  • Work on new requirements, application enhancements, and bug fixes.
  • Maintain code in a Git repository.
  • Create DevOps configuration files and scripts.
  • Assist with escalated customer tickets.
  • Route, transform, and enrich data.
  • Collaborate with data source and data destination customers.

Qualifications
Required:
  • Active TS/SCI w/ Polygraph
  • 14+ years of experience as a Software Engineer in programs and contracts of similar scope.
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related discipline from an accredited college or university.
  • API development experience.
  • Scripting skills (preferably Python).
  • Proficiency with Git and Jira.
  • Experience in at least four of the following technologies:
    • JavaScript
    • Regular Expressions (RegEx)
    • REST Services
    • Python frameworks
    • Elasticsearch/Splunk
    • CI/CD processes
    • Monitoring tools (Nagios, Elastic Beats)
    • Apache NiFi
    • React or Angular
    • DevOps tools (Ansible, Salt, Docker)
    • Cribl
